Context for the new contractor: we're replacing our homegrown queue (Cartwheel) with the managed Beltline scheduler. The migration worker reads Cartwheel's database credentials from the Quartzbin vault, but last night's failed deploy exhausted the unseal retries and the vault is now hard-locked. Until it's unsealed, the cutover is stalled and jobs keep running on Cartwheel. To unseal: open the Quartzbin admin CLI, run the unlock command, and supply the recovery passphrase given below.

unlock words, yawig-kagef: gordor-holvan-ulaael-pramir-ulaiel-tamdor

Ticket: Drift in vendored font configuration — Typeset pipeline

We vendor third-party fonts into the Glimmerkit build rather than loading them remotely, but the production bundler now references font paths and subset ranges that diverge from the committed manifest. Plugin authors relying on the documented font set may see fallbacks. Please reconcile carefully before the next release. Production currently runs with the following values.

service settings:
[casax]
port = 6379
team = rusir
host = casax.zemvarhq.corp
region = outer-4
access_code = ac_9808ce
timeout_ms = 1500

// Broker upgrade notes for plugin authors:
// Quillbus 4.x replaces the legacy 3.x wire protocol. Plugins must
// construct the client with explicit protocol negotiation enabled,
// or connections to the Larkfield cluster will be silently downgraded
// and dropped after 30s. Topic names are unchanged. For local testing
// against the sandbox broker, authenticate with the key below.

API key for bafof-bagaf: qvz2-qi

Effective next quarter, Tarvik Freight replaces Hollenbeck Carriers for all outbound shipments from the Drayfield hub. Reasons: repeated delays on the Avenmoor corridor, rising surcharges, and weak tracking coverage. Tarvik's bid is 9% lower with guaranteed 48-hour regional delivery. Transition window is six weeks; dual-running during weeks three and four. Department heads must update routing tables and brief warehouse leads by Friday. Escalate capacity concerns to the transition group immediately. Context for the switch is summarized below.

confidential, bahap-bajog: Zorethix Works is in early talks to buy Kelethox Foods for about $30.7 million. The Ralvan launch date is September 19, and nothing goes to the press before then.